Avocet, Recurvirostra avosetta
Local status: Rare passage migrant
Avocets are a conservation success story and as their numbers increase in Yorkshire, records from the York area will only increase. It is highly possible that the first breeding record may not be too far away, although the availability of suitable habitat will be the limiting factor. Spring passage seems to be the best time to locate Avocets in the York area, usually between March and May, with
smaller numbers appearing post-breeding.
